Program

LCLAA's Internship Program

Organization

Labor Council for Latin American Advancement

Opportunity Type

Internship

About the Program

In an effort to reach out to the Latino community and increase youth leadership development, LCLAA hosts full and part-time, unpaid internships at their Washington, D.C. headquarters all year. Interns will have the opportunity to get involved in an organization that works to educate mobilize and advance the economic, social and political interests of Latino workers, their families and their communities.

Areas include: Communications, Policy & Advocacy and Environmental Research & Advocacy.

Additional Benefits

This unique internship helps to develop leadership skills in areas such as communications, organizing, and event planning and team management.

Requirements

Description

Qualifications:

  • Basic Computer skills, Knowledge of Microsoft office (MS Word, Excell, Powerpoint, etc).
  • Bilingual applicants in both Spanish and English are preferred although exceptions may be made for exceptional candidates.
  • Experience/Knowledge or familiarity with labor unions and non-profit work a big plus.
  • Must have strong interpersonal and communications skills.
  • We look for respectful individuals that follow directions, demonstrate creativity, excellent work ethic, flexibility and initiative.
  • Knowledge of HTML language, Photoshop, and Adobe illustrator are desirable but not required (Communications Intern).
